摘要
Given the high level of energy consumption and its impact on environment over the last decades, policy decision-makers are increasingly recognizing the need to take actions that allow to address unsustainable energy consumption patterns. One field of action has been the promotion of measures that contribute to improve energy efficiency of countries. The purpose of this study is to identify the factors that drive changes in energy efficiency applying the multiplicative Log Mean Divisia Index (LMDI) decomposition method for a set of countries. The results show that overall energy efficiency trends displays different patterns between countries and the same happens within each country from a sectorial perspective. Major drivers of improvements of overall energy efficiency were the intensity effect and the affluence effect, whereas the driver that hampered those improvements was the energy consumption per capita. Policy decision-makers should support measures that promote the adoption of energy-saving technologies resulting from new technological developments.
